Long-Term Orientation Over Quarterly Thinking
Short-term goal systems reward immediate effects, not sustainable quality. UX becomes a lever for metrics.
Mature organizations invest in foundations: clarity, consistency, trust. Returns come later—but last longer.
Strategy is revealed by where patience is exercised.
